My baby is eleven months old but he has a lot of cough and cough problem

1 Answer
profile image of POOJA KOTHARIPOOJA KOTHARIMom of a 8 yr 7 m old boy6 months ago

A. If your 11-month-old baby is experiencing persistent cough, it could be due to a variety of reasons such as a common cold, allergies, or a respiratory infection. To help alleviate the cough, ensure your baby is well-hydrated and give warm fluids like water or mild soup. Use a humidifier in the room to keep the air moist and reduce throat irritation. Gentle chest rubs with baby-safe ointments (like Vicks Baby Rub) may also provide relief. If the cough lasts more than a few days, is accompanied by fever, or the baby has trouble breathing, it is essential to consult a pediatrician to rule out any serious issues like bronchiolitis or pneumonia.
